Output 3b59662bc9d3c6d9ff0c13f4a35838a2174a0d61cd29ae6d6cb20f45636d8297:2

value
76750879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1bfe084f76018bd9d24fec417f0262441a74e9c OP_EQUAL
address
MQ71hEWyFs7dKR7DSWavKVMgof42txqbCq
transaction
3b59662bc9d3c6d9ff0c13f4a35838a2174a0d61cd29ae6d6cb20f45636d8297
spent
true